>From my experiance, DO also works for simple tools (in GNUstep Base Source). 
>Not sure
for complex case. And for GUI, at least for me, is not proper for production 
environment.
I think Base can be used for your application and GUI to be created with Win32 
API. I did
make a simple administation tool (with Win 32 GUI) for management and for us, 
it's not
a problem installing GNUstep Base. With install shield packaging system, whole 
application
+ gnustep-base installed like a breeze. (Think that gnustep-base is like a MFC 
in VC++).
